PROFILE: Rich and DecadentWITH NOTES OF Amaretto, Cherry, Dark ChocolateROAST: Medium Roast For Espresso Brewing Download the Ratnagiri Estate, India Transparency Report ABOUT For nearly a century, the Patre family has stewarded Ratnagiri Estate, producing specialty coffee and fine pepper. Ashok Patre, the third generation to work the land alongside his wife, Divya, is securing the farms future by making it one of the most impressive operations we‚Äôve seen - not just in India, but globally. Mr. Patre’ s processing methods are both intentional and impressive. He understands that Indian terroir and varieties can only produce specialty coffee of a particular character. Consequently, he has developed processing methods that create something unique and exceptional. This coffee is naturally processed and underwent anaerobic fermentation in custom-made bioreactors for 36 hours with lab-isolated microbes before drying on raised beds for 25 days.
